Output b76590e85a2a5ffeb5549b3708391df3fb9dd9ad72e2486dc7a9f59dcd0f3a11:23

value
4269157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a96af3084818637914ac8590f133e19d35c68116 OP_EQUAL
address
3H8pEw7nM6fQzmN4qDfpU8r2s2rnYRGfvT
transaction
b76590e85a2a5ffeb5549b3708391df3fb9dd9ad72e2486dc7a9f59dcd0f3a11
confirmations
347643
spent
true